  4. to leave or escape from a person or place, often when it is difficult to do this: We walked to the next beach to get away from the crowds. I'll get away from work as soon as I can. B2. to go somewhere to have a holiday, often because you need to rest: I just need to get away for a few days. Menos ejemplos.
